2024 The DearMoon project was cancelled, with organizers citing delays to the Starship program as the reason.
December 4 2024 T.O.P. was revealed as a cast member for the second season of Squid Game, where he played a character named Thanos, a former rapper who faced struggles with a drug problem and a crypto scam.
2023 Originally scheduled lunar spaceflight mission for the DearMoon project.
2023 The lunar spaceflight mission involving T.O.P was scheduled to occur aboard the SpaceX Starship.
May 31 2023 T.O.P. confirmed that he had withdrawn from BigBang, marking a significant transition in his career after many years with the group.
2022 T.O.P was selected to participate in a lunar spaceflight as part of the DearMoon project crew.
February 7 2022 YG Entertainment announced that BigBang would make their comeback with a new song on April 5, while also revealing that T.O.P. had ended his exclusive contract with the company but would continue with group activities.
March 3 2020 Under his legal name, T.O.P donated ₩100 million to the Hope Bridge National Disaster Association in Daegu to provide personal protective equipment for local medical staff during the COVID-19 pandemic.
2019 T.O.P. became the first K-pop singer to be named to a list of 200 artists in the art world at Growse Magazine, marking a significant achievement in his artistic career.
July 8 2019 T.O.P's official dispensation from military service took place.
July 6 2019 T.O.P was officially discharged from his military service.
November 4 2018 In honor of T.O.P's birthday, his fans from four Asian countries donated ₩11 million (approximately US$9,900) to the Yongsan Welfare Foundation to assist those in need.
June 29 2018 At his first trial for marijuana usage charges, T.O.P pleaded guilty and admitted to smoking marijuana in four instances in early October 2016, resulting in two years of probation.
January 26 2018 T.O.P resumed his mandatory military service as a public service officer at the Yongsan Arts and Crafts Center in central Seoul.

June 8 2017 T.O.P's mother confirmed that he regained consciousness and was recovering after being found unconscious due to a suspected overdose.
February 9 2017 T.O.P began his two-year mandatory military service as a conscripted police officer.
2016 T.O.P appeared as himself in the documentary 'Big Bang Made'.
2016 After spending most of 2015 promoting BigBang's album Made, T.O.P was cast in the German-Chinese film Out of Control alongside Hong Kong actress Cecilia Cheung, which is scheduled for release in China.
October 2016 T.O.P curated a contemporary art collection for a charity auction in Hong Kong, named #TTTOP, in collaboration with Sotheby's. The auction raised over HK$ 135 million, with part of the proceeds donated to the Asian Cultural Council to support emerging Asian artists.
2015 T.O.P debuted as a furniture designer in collaboration with Vitra, and was awarded the Visual Culture Award at the Prudential Eye Awards.
